Do memory foam mattresses squeak?

Foam mattresses won't cause squeaking, so if you have a memory foam mattress or a latex bed, it's best to assume your bed itself is not the source. However, innerspring and hybrid mattresses—both of which contain coils—are at risk of making noise.

Why does my foam mattress squeak?

All-foam and all-latex mattresses, on the other hand, will not squeak, as they have no metal components. Box springs will squeak for the same reason as innerspring mattresses: They utilize hundreds of metal coils, which can rub together more as they wear out.

How do I get my mattress to stop squeaking?

Add padding.

Take some of those old socks or T-shirts and layer them on top of the slats of your bed frame. This creates a barrier between the mattress and the wood or metal bed frame, so they don't have too much friction between them, which may be the cause of the awful squeaking noise.

What makes a bed squeak?

Loose joints are a common cause of a squeaky bed. Check all the bolts on your bed frame to see if they might be the source of your problem. If you find that any bolts are loose, use a wrench to tighten them.

How do I stop my mattress spring from squeaking?

Place a flat, rigid object right underneath the offending mattress spring. A hardcover book or piece of plywood are good objects to try. The pressure will likely reduce, and maybe even eradicate, the squeaking.

Is my mattress or box spring squeaking?

“The boxspring is the most common source of a bed squeaking,” says Cote. “It's either the boxspring itself, the wood on wood components inside, or it could be the wood of the box spring rubbing on the metal frame.” To test your boxspring, slide it off the frame and, again, gently sit or roll around on it.

Why does my box spring make so much noise?

The coils and wooden panel in box springs are the most common source of squeaking. Springs naturally deteriorate over time and squeak due to metal rubbing on metal. However, the noise does not always originate from the internal parts of the box spring.

How do I know if my box spring is worn out?

Four Signs Your Box Spring Is Worn Out
  1. It makes a creaking or squeaking noise when weight or pressure is put on it.
  2. If you can see any sagging or bowing anywhere across the platform.
  3. If you can see any bending or damage to the steel grid.
  4. If the steel springs are more than 10 years old they're probably starting to wear out.

Whats a box spring do?

The box spring is intended to serve a few purposes: To provide underlying support for the mattress. To raise the mattress up to a more comfortable height. To protect the mattress by absorbing impact.
